Big Data refers to very large collections of data. These data sets are typically too large to be processed traditionally and are usually held in non-structured or NoSQL data stores. Non-structured Data includes files such as photos, emails, audio, or sensor data. First coined in Deb Dana's book Polyvagal Theory in Therapy, "glimmers" are the micromoments in your day that spark a sense of joy. They can be anything from catching a view of the skyline to cuddling with your pet. Glimmers tell your nervous system that you are safe and okay in the world, thus shifting your system's response from defense to calm. When we notice and name glimmers, we train our nervous system to be open to more of these moments—expanding our overall sense of well-being. Phenology is all about timing—when trees leaf out, flowers bloom, birds migrate, animals bear young and hibernate—and it is everywhere around us.
